Leiza Dolghih to Moderate Panel at CAIL Conference on Intellectual Property Law

Dallas, Texas (November 3, 2021) – Dallas Partner Elisaveta "Leiza" Dolghih will moderate a panel on trade secrets at The Center for American and International Law (CAIL) 59th Annual Conference on Intellectual Property Law on November 9 at 2:55 p.m. CT.  

This informative 60-minute session titled “Building A Trade Secret Program” will feature a panel of experts who will provide insights into building a successful trade secrets protection program, from reasonable measures to best practices in handling employees’ departures. CLE credits are available.  

CAIL is a nonprofit organization dedicated to improving the quality of justice through the education of lawyers and law enforcement officials in the United States and across the globe. 

Ms. Dolghih is co-chair of Lewis Brisbois’ Trade Secrets & Non-Compete Disputes Practice and has extensive courtroom experience, including multiple jury trials, bench trials, and injunction evidentiary hearings. She advises clients on the best protection measures for their trade secrets and, when necessary, litigates trade secrets misappropriation, non-competition, non-solicitation, and other claims that are frequently brought when employees move between competing employers.
